5.4 Lens shift, zoom & focus
Motorized lens adjustment
The SP2K-S projector is equipped with a motorized lens shift functionality and a motorized zoom & focus
functionality.
About the shift range
The lens can be shifted with respect to the internal optics of the projector (DMD) which results in a shifted
image on the screen (Off-Axis). A 100% shift means that the center point of the projected image is shifted by
half the screen size. In other words, the center point of the projected image falls together with the outline of the
image in an On-Axis projection. Due to mechanical and optical limitations the shift range is limited as well.
All lenses have a shift range of 40% up, 70% down, 15% left, and 15% right. This range is valid for all throw
ratios. Within these shift ranges the projector and lens perform excellently (color/brightness uniformity is ok).
Configuring the projector outside these shift ranges will result in a slight decline of image quality.
It’s mechanical possible to shift outside the recommended field of view, but this will result in a
decline of image quality depending on the used lens and the zoom position of the used lens.
Furthermore, shifting too much in both directions will result in a blurred image corner (and color/
brightness uniformity is out of spec).

Take into account that when using Scheimpflug to adjust the lens holder, the shift range will become
asymmetrical as a direct consequence. An up/down shift range of 30%/70% could (for example)
become 25%/75% instead after Scheimpflug adjustment.
For this reason it is advised to perform Scheimpflug adjustment
after
you have reached the
sharpest possible image using lens shift, zoom and focus.
How to shift the lens of the SP2K-S projector?
1.
In the
Configuration – Lens Selection
menu, Select the correct lens file and the calibrate the selected lens
with a
Calibrate & return to mid position
action.
2.
Use the
up and down
arrow keys in the
Light, dowser, lens
menu to shift the lens
vertically
and use the
left and right
arrow keys to shift the lens
horizontally
.
